摘要
Fretting fatigue crack initiation behaviour was investigated for its dependence on the microstructure of a alpha/beta titanium alloy, which ranged from homogeneous duplex to the fully transformed heterogeneous lamellar texture by increasing the Widmanstatten colony size. When the microstructure changed from homogeneous duplex to the fully transformed heterogeneous lamellar texture, the resistance to fretting fatigue crack initiation decreased. And, this was just the opposite of short and long crack behaviour where the resistance to crack growth increases when the microstructure changes from homogeneous duplex to the fully transformed heterogeneous lamellar structure.
